Guilty Gear -Strive- Features Branching Arcade Mode | Niche Gamer
Arc System Works have updated the Guilty Gear -Strive- website, revealing the fighting game’s Arcade Mode will have branching stories. The new How To page for various game modes has been added to the website, detailing the features of Tutorial, Arcade, Mission, Survival, and Training. MoreGuilty Gear -Strive- Supports Cross-Play Between PS4 and PS5, Next-Gen Upgrade | Niche Gamer
Arc System Works have revealed Guilty Gear -Strive- will support cross-play between PlayStation 4 and PlayStation 5, along with a free next-gen upgrade. The game launches April 9th, 2021 on Windows PC (via Steam), PlayStation 4, and PlayStation 5. SiliconEra reports the latest news post on the game’s Japanese website, detailing a pre-purchase FAQ.
